☐ Bulk edits — admin table (GridDesk). Verify that every bulk operation logs the affected row IDs, the before/after values, and the initiating account. Confirm the undo window is set to 15 minutes and that support can trigger a rollback without engineering help. Any discrepancy must be escalated immediately to the audit owner:

named custodian: Brivan Eliath Quenox Frador

Ticket: Expired credentials blocking formula sandbox validation. The Quillbox sandbox service, which isolates user-supplied formulas before execution, has been rejecting requests since the old key lapsed on Tuesday. This blocks the release gate that verifies sandbox escapes are caught. I've confirmed the new credential works against staging and has the same scope as the old one. Please update the release pipeline with the key below.

app token of bahaf-tajeg = zpat23_SjjsllwiLmXbtS65veZaV47

Subject: Divestiture of Hollowpine Logistics unit

Executive team,

We have signed a definitive agreement to sell the Hollowpine Logistics unit to Marrowfield Group. Closing is expected within ninety days, pending regulatory review in Estermark. Sales leads should route all Hollowpine pipeline questions to Dorian until transition plans are finalized. No external statements yet. Context on next steps appears in the confidential note below.

board note of kageg-bahof: The renewal with Holwynax Holdings closes at $2 million a year, 5 percent below the last contract. Project Ulaath slips by two quarters because of the supplier delay.

Attendees agreed the twelve nitrate-era film reels from the Fenwick Collection will move to the Greylock Archive vault next Tuesday. Reels are to travel in their fire-rated cases, upright, with temperature logging enabled throughout. Dispatch will book a dedicated climate-controlled van rather than adding the cases to a mixed load, given their fragility and value. The archive's receiving clerk will be on duty from 09:00. It was minuted that the courier hand-over proceed per the following instruction:

handover note for bajog-tawig: the lamion quenael courier leaves the wendor ledger at gate 1289 under passcode 760784